I'm a medium-sized woman. hair that is curly It's hard to put into words, but they're more like "constant, persistent tangles" than "curls. " The teeth on these combs are small and close together, which makes them ideal for getting rid of tangles and straightening hair. The only issue is that the teeth are made of plastic, and the pressure required to remove tangles has broken the ends of a few teeth and bent the ends of others. I'm not sure when I bought these, but I've been using one almost every day for the past two months, so that should give you an idea of how long you can expect them to last. Moreover, while the teasing back comb is entertaining to use, it is made of a material that feels weaker than the aluminum used in soda cans. I'm not sure if that's the proper way to make teasing combs - I'd never seen one before, but each of the four ends is permanently bent, so I have to manually straighten them before using them. I have fairly large hands, and the comb isn't long enough for me to comfortably hold while combing without poking myself with the teasing prongs (which may also explain their bending). br>br>I don't want to give the impression that these combs are bad - they aren't. because they are definitely worth the money in my opinion, but I just wanted to make sure you were aware of the disadvantages so you could make an informed decision. My main point is that if you want to keep these for a long time, you shouldn't buy them because they won't last that long in their original condition.
